Thomas Partey is gradually returning to service. After a period of absence due to injury, the Ghana international finally reunited with his Arsenal teammates as he trained with them on Tuesday.
This February 20, 2024, Thomas Partey took part in training with his teammates, as Arsenal prepare to face FC Porto on Wednesday February 21 in the UEFA Champions League. Images published by the club on Tuesday show the player in full training. It is very likely that he will return to the pitch after a few more sessions.
Gunners coach Mikel Arteta reassured a few days ago that the midfielder’s injury was not serious and that his recovery was rapid despite his relapse at the end of January 2024.
A long absence
Thomas Partey had been sidelined since November 2023 due to injury.
This unavailability deprived him of participation in the African Cup of Nations with the Black Stars of Ghana in Ivory Coast. His return therefore marks a glimmer of hope for Arsenal and their supporters, who are impatiently waiting to see him on the pitch again.
